Function and health of organisms depends on function and health of its cells. Function of cells depends on proteins that are encoded in genes. All organisms are composed of one or more cells. The cell is the basic unit of structure and organization in organisms. Microscopy is photography of small things (like cells). Light of one wavelength is absorbed, and light of a different wavelength is released. Filters allow us to separate different colors. Scientists can copy and reuse that gene. We have found and made additional colors. We can now make multi-color movies of cells. Resolution allows us to see objects as separate from one another. Adaptive optics have long been used in telescopes for astronomy. Applied to biology, it allows imaging of networks of neurons inside the brain of a living zebrafish.
